Ranch rodeo

Saturday June 27th 2PM

Watch working ranch teams from across the Northwest compete in real-life events:

Team Sorting

Branding

Team Pasture Roping

Team Doctoring

PLUS stick horse races for all kids in attendance!

Buckaroo Rodeo

The Buckaroo Rodeo returns to the Chief Joseph Days Rodeo event lineup. Open to special needs children and adults regardless of age.
Events:
Stick and bouncy horse races
Dummy Steer Roping
Dummy Bucking Bull Riding
Goat Tail Untying
Ride in the famous Chief Joseph Days Rodeo Stagecoach

All contestants will be awarded a buckle, t-shirt, hat, bandana, lariat, and ticket to the Wednesday PRCA Rodeo performance.

Contestants are invited to join the Grand Entry during the PRCA performance on the stagecoach. Entries begin on Wednesday, July 22nd at 9:30 am at the Harley Tucker Memorial Arena.

Friendship Feast
Jul
25

Friendship Feast

A reunion of tradition, pride, and friendship...
The Nez Perce gather at the Encampment Pavilion north of the CJD Rodeo Arena to share their culture and traditions with locals and visitors alike starting at Noon with the Friendship Feast followed by Traditional Indian Dance Contests.
